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and fixing issues with the structural base that supports a building. Over time, foundations can develop probl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, which may compromise the stability of a property. Skilled contractors use various techniques, including underpinning, slab jacking, and piering, to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ity. These repairs are designed to address existing damage, prevent further deterioration, and ensure the safety and longevity of the property.

Many foundation problems st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s indicating a need for repair include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around door frames.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more serious structural damage, reduce the risk of costly repairs later, and improve the overall safety of the home. The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in College Grove,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s in College Grove range from $250 to $600. Many routine crack repairs and small f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age. Fewer projects tend to reach the higher end of this band.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, such as fixing larger cracks or minor settling issues, us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Many local contractors handle these projects within this middle range, though costs can vary based on specific conditions.

Major Restoration - Significant foundation stabilization or repair projects often fall in the $3,500 to $7,000 range. Larger, more complex projects, including pier and beam work, are less common but can reach higher costs depending on the scope.

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acements in College Grove can range from $10,000 to $30,000 or more. These are typically reserved for severe cases and represent the upper end of typical project costs handled by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around door frames or moldings.

How do local contractors typically repair concrete foundations? They may use methods such as underpinning, piering, slab jacking, or crack injection to stabilize and restore the foundation's integrity.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? While small cracks can sometimes be cosmetic, it’s advisable to have a professional evaluate whether they indicate underlying issues requiring repair.

What factors can cause foundation issues in College Grove, TN? Soil settlement, moisture fluctuations, tree roots, and poor drainage are common contributors to foundation problems in the area.
